The Wūru® Women's 7/8 Baselayer Tech Pant, Made in the USA. Designed to be snug next to the skin, following your every move. 

Through rigorous testing, gone are the days of needing a 3/4 length base layer for skiing/riding and a full-length for all other winter activities.  We’ve simplified the getting out of the house process for you with our 7/8 length pants with a yoga pant-inspired waistband. 

FABRIC OVERVIEW:

Product Weight: Medium

Fabric: 95% Merino, 5% Elastane

Fabric Weight: 210gsm 

Knit in Australia: 18.9 Micron

Made From: Non-mulesed Australian merino wool

FEATURES:

  • Handmade in the USA from premium Australian wool
  • Yoga-inspired waistband
  • Flatlock seams to eliminate chafing 
  • Body-mapped cut to follow your every movement.
  • Naturally odor-resistant and antibacterial.
  • Exceptionally soft Merino wool for pure comfort.
  • Blended with a touch of Elastane for extra durability.
  • Made from sustainable and ethically sourced fabric.

 

CARE:

Machine Wash Cold Gentle Cycle.  Do Not Bleach.  Tumble Dry Low (hang/flat dry for best results).  Cool Iron As Needed.  Do Not Dry Clean.

Too short, weird fit

I really wanted to like these, made domestically with Nuyarn (the most superior merino material that I've used for backcountry activities). But the leggings fell short in every way. They are definitely not 7/8 length. I'm only 5'5" and size small fit like capris (3/4 length), so there's a cold gap between the hem and the top of my tall socks. I bought these because the size chart says small is 26 1/4" inseam, but I measure the inseam as 23.5". In comparison, my other 7/8 pants are closer to 25". They are also not 4-way stretch, only 2-way stretch. They're very stiff in the vertical direction and I feel resistance when I pull my knees towards my chest in a high step. I wanted to use these for running and climbing, so I need the 4-way stretch. The waist band looked like a comfortable wide yoga-style waist in the photos, which is unique for base layers and a big draw of this garment, but when I pulled them on I still found a restricting thin band at the top that cut into my belly, whereas the wide part is *too stretchy* horizontally and doesn't hug the waist, instead bagging out. Additionally, the fit is off, and I have bagging at the hip flexors that cause the leggings to ride down when I move my legs. The 145gsm weight is just too light, feels like my summer hiking merino shirt. So disappointed after reading all the positive reviews and having to do a return. I'd like to meet the people who did the "rigorous testing", maybe there were no small women on the team? Hopefully I just got a mis-cut pair and these are actually as great at the reviews make them seem.
